Déjà Vu is a captivating and thought-provoking short film that was written by our talented students. It aims to raise awareness on suicide and bullying prevention. The play revolves around a young man who is haunted by his social status and the pressure of being in the limelight, which leads him to keep his struggles a secret. Through a series of flashbacks, the audience is shown the events that have contributed to his disappearance and how the people around him had interacted with him last. As the story progresses, the play forces the audience to confront difficult questions about mental health, trauma, and the human experience. With the help of a skilled cast and crew, "Deja Vu" guarantees to be a moving and unforgettable production that will leave the audience with a renewed sense of empathy and understanding for those who are going through tough times.
